This course, created by Christine Topfer, provides practical classroom strategies and tools to set students up for success in spelling. The course supports teachers to plan and teach effective spelling strategies through recognising visual patterns, the meaning of word bases and the origin of words. This course will support teachers to plan and teach the following effective spelling strategies:

  • Recognising visual patterns (visual and orthographic knowledge)
  • Understanding the meaning of word bases, prefixes and suffixes (morphemic knowledge)
  • Making use of knowledge about the history of words (etymologic knowledge)
  • Transferring knowledge about likely spelling patterns 

Learning outcomes: 

  • Create a classroom culture that supports word study
  • Learn about how words work and what students need to know
  • Use assessment strategies for spelling
  • Apply strategies to support learning about words
  • Orchestrate spelling instruction in the classroom
